Output 6580098f82a7e5d1fb92ab1901a0722fdb0069ad843327a64bcb87ccb31e76cf:0

value
1507254
script pubkey
OP_0 OP_PUSHBYTES_20 2c0cc2d5a160f2678720f746fb510475d9152aa8
address
bc1q9sxv94dpvrex0peq7ar0k5gywhv3224ga5pcxk
transaction
6580098f82a7e5d1fb92ab1901a0722fdb0069ad843327a64bcb87ccb31e76cf
confirmations
186198
spent
true